YOUR APPLICATION MUST DESCRIBE YOUR QUALIFICATIONS AS THEY RELATE TO:

  • Considerable experience in performing general maintenance, construction and repairs to buildings, parks, mechanical equipment and services using a wide range of equipment, with the ability to provide estimates of necessary work repairs required.
  • Experience with road maintenance procedures and materials used.
  • Experience in reading and interpreting drawings and specifications and in overseeing work performed by city staff.
  • Experience with inspecting construction activities.
  • Experience in the safe and efficient operation of all vehicles, equipment, hand tools and power tools related to the duties of this position.
  • Must possess and be able to maintain a valid Province of Ontario Class “DZ” Driver’s License and must qualify for the City’s equipment operating permits and requirements.
Responsibilities
  • Leads projects, organizes and directs the day-to-day activities of unionized staff.
  • Oversees & inspects the work of unionized staff to ensure compliance with City standards & specifications, and health & safety.
  • Performs tasks required for the installation, operation, general maintenance and repair of equipment, roads and sidewalks, not requiring the services of a licensed trade worker.
  • Marks areas on roads, sidewalks, curbs, and gutters, etc./ to be repaired/constructed by crews.
  • Schedules material sampling for laboratory testing.
  • Performs administrative and processing activities as required, such as updating service requests and work orders in EWMS Maximo & TMMS, and manual records.
  • Ensures proper traffic control set-ups in accordance with safety guidelines.
  • Operates and performs minor maintenance on various types of motor vehicles and equipment relevant to the duties of the position including tractors, backhoes and other specialized equipment, including operating power equipment and specialized tools.
  • Assigns work, establishes maintenance schedules to meet prescribed standards, instructs, trains and orients staff in all aspects of maintenance and provides feedback on performance.
  • Requisitions supplies and services and maintains records of equipment inventory and other assets.
  • Ensures that the work location, equipment and supplies meet health and safety standards and completes all requisite inspections.
  • Reads and interprets plans; performs quantity takeoffs and layout of projects.
  • Schedules and arranges delivery of materials; equipment; and services of contractors and trades staff to ensure timely and efficient completion of projects
  • Attends all training provided by the City related to the discharge of job duties.
  • Ensures that appropriate action is taken to deal with incidents, problems and emergencies in accordance with divisional policies and procedures.
  • Interprets and works in accordance with all legislation, codes and regulations related to the responsibilities of the position.
  • Communicates and ensures good customer service to community groups, members of the public and other staff. Investigates public complaints and takes appropriate action.
  • Responds to inquiries from City staff, contractors, other municipalities, businesses, public and 311.
  • Completes written reports, daily logbook and activity sheets, and forms as required, including providing statistical information concerning tasks completed, staff issues, accident/incident reports, time sheets and facility use.
  • Contacts and meets with representatives of the utilities to locate services, vendors (suppliers) and keeps thorough records.
  • Performs other related work and specific projects as assigned.
